Collective Choice Processes: A Qualitative and Quantitative Analysis of Foreign Policy Decision-Making

Gallhofer and Saris examine the collective choice processes in different decision-making units leading to World Wars I and II as well as the Cuban Missile Crisis, colonial wars, and to major foreign policy decisions of a European government after World War II.
